ADJUSTMENTS TO HIGHER SALARY LEVELS Sample Clauses

The "Adjustments to Higher Salary Levels" clause establishes the conditions and procedures for modifying an employee's salary when they are promoted or move into a position with a higher pay grade. Typically, this clause outlines how the new salary is determined, such as by applying a percentage increase or aligning with the minimum of the new salary range, and may specify timing for when the adjustment takes effect. Its core function is to ensure a fair and transparent process for salary changes associated with career advancement, thereby promoting consistency and equity within the organization.
